Nico Collins Undergoes Concussion Assessment in Locker Room

Nico Collins, a key receiver for the Houston Texans, is undergoing a concussion assessment after a worrying incident during a recent game. The incident occurred early in the fourth quarter when Collins hit his head against the turf, prompting immediate medical attention.

Nico Collins’ Injury Update

The Texans announced that Collins is questionable to return to the game. He was seen on the ESPN broadcast entering the sideline medical tent before being taken to the locker room for more thorough evaluation.

Game Performance

  • Collins recorded four receptions.
  • He totaled 27 receiving yards before exiting the game.

As of midway through the fourth quarter, the Seattle Seahawks held a commanding 27-12 lead over the Texans.

Concussion Status

In an update released at 1:18 a.m. ET, the Texans confirmed that Collins has been ruled out due to the concussion. This development raises concerns about his health and availability for upcoming games.
